Web Based Training Programmer - HTML/JavaScript
With annual sales of $2 billion and more than 11,000 employees, Raytheon Technical Services Company LLC (RTSC) provides technology solutions for defense, federal and commercial customers worldwide. It specializes in Mission Support, customized engineering services, engineering product solutions and engineering service solutions. RTSC operates in 38 states, 37 countries and all seven continents Job Description: Participate in the development of web-based training materials for the Zumwalt Destroyer Training Program (DDG 1000). Will be responsible for programming and maintaining html/JavaScript development templates used to create web-based training files to run in a SCORM conformant learning management system. Required Skills: à Intermediate or Expert level HTML/JavaScript programming skills. à Must be eligible to obtain a Secret clearance (or above) required. à Excellent communication skills. à Ability to work alone with little supervision as well as be part of a team of developers. à Eight years of experience Desired Skills: à XML and Flash experience. à Expertise in the use of Photoshop/Illustrator. à Experience with SCORM. à Military experience. à Knowledge of Navy training systems and requirements. Required Education (including Major): Bachelors in Web Technologies or similar area. Experience can substitute for educational requirements.
